![]() |
![]() |
|
TI-RTOS Drivers
tidrivers_full_2_20_00_08
|
| ADC.h | ADC driver interface |
| ADCBuf.h | ADCBuf driver interface |
| ADCBufCC26XX.h | ADCBuf driver implementation for a CC26XX analog-to-digital converter |
| ADCCC26XX.h | ADC driver implementation for the ADC peripheral on CC26XX |
| ADCMSP432.h | ADC driver implementation for the ADC peripheral on MSP432 |
| buzzer.h | PWM-based buzzer interface |
| Camera.h | Camera driver interface |
| CameraCC3200DMA.h | Camera driver implementation for a CC3200 Camera controller |
| ClockP.h | Clock interface for the RTOS Porting Interface |
| Codec1.h | Implementation of TI Codec Type 1 (IMA ADPCM) encoding and decoding |
| CryptoCC26XX.h | Crypto driver implementation for a CC26XX Crypto controller |
| DebugP.h | Debug support |
| diskio.h | |
| Display.h | Generic interface for text output |
| DisplayDogm1286.h | |
| DisplayExt.h | Extention of Display to access GrLib functionality in capable displays |
| DisplayLog.h | |
| DisplaySharp.h | |
| DisplayUart.h | |
| EMAC.h | EMAC driver interface |
| EMACSnow.h | EMACSnow Driver |
| EMACTiva.h | EMACTiva Driver |
| ExtFlash.h | External flash storage abstraction |
| ff.h | |
| ffcio.h | |
| ffconf.h | |
| fsutils.h | |
| GPIO.h | GPIO driver |
| GPIOCC26XX.h | CC26XX GPIO driver |
| GPIOCC3200.h | CC3200 GPIO driver |
| GPIOMSP430.h | MSP430 GPIO driver |
| GPIOMSP432.h | MSP432 GPIO driver |
| GPIOTiva.h | Tiva GPIO driver |
| GPTimerCC26XX.h | GPTimer driver implementation for CC26XX/CC13XX |
| grlib.h | |
| HwiP.h | Hardware Interrupt module for the RTOS Porting Interface |
| I2C.h | I2C driver interface |
| I2CCC26XX.h | I2C driver implementation for a CC26XX I2C controller |
| I2CCC3200.h | I2C driver implementation for a CC3200 I2C controller |
| I2CEUSCIB.h | I2CEUSCIB driver implementation for an EUSCIB controller |
| I2CMSP432.h | I2C driver implementation for the EUSCI controller on MSP432 |
| I2CSlave.h | I2CSlave driver interface |
| I2CSlaveMSP432.h | I2CSlave driver implementation for the EUSCI controller on MSP432 |
| I2CTiva.h | I2C driver implementation for a Tiva I2C controller |
| I2CUSCIB.h | I2CUSCIB driver implementation for a USCIB controller |
| I2S.h | I2S driver interface |
| I2SCC3200DMA.h | I2S driver implementation for a CC3200 I2S controller |
| integer.h | |
| LCDDogm1286.h | LCD driver implementation for a DOGM128W-6 LCD display |
| LCDDogm1286_util.h | |
| List.h | Linked List interface for use in drivers |
| MutexP.h | Mutex module for the RTOS Porting Interface |
| NVS.h | PRELIMINARY Non-Volatile Storage Driver |
| NVSCC26XX.h | |
| NVSCC3200.h | |
| NVSMSP432.h | |
| NVSTiva.h | |
| PDMCC26XX.h | PDM driver implementation for a CC26XX PDM controller |
| PDMCC26XX_util.h | PDM utility includes helper functions for configuring the CC26XX I2S controller |
| PIN.h | Generic PIN & GPIO driver |
| PINCC26XX.h | Device-specific pin & GPIO driver for CC26xx family [def] |
| Power.h | Power manager interface |
| PowerCC26XX.h | Power manager interface for CC26XX |
| PowerCC3200.h | Power manager interface for the CC3200 |
| PowerMSP432.h | Power manager interface for the MSP432 |
| PWM.h | PWM driver interface |
| PWMTimerCC26XX.h | PWM driver implementation for CC26XX/CC13XX |
| PWMTimerCC3200.h | PWM driver implementation using CC3200 General Purpose Timers |
| PWMTimerMSP432.h | PWM driver implementation using Timer_A peripherals |
| PWMTimerTiva.h | PWM driver implementation using Tiva General Purpose Timers |
| PWMTiva.h | PWM driver implementation for Tiva PWM peripherals |
| RF.h | RF driver for the CC26/13xx family |
| RingBuf.h | |
| SDHostCC3200.h | SDHost driver implementation for the CC3200 |
| SDSPI.h | SDSPI driver interface |
| SDSPICC3200.h | SDSPI driver implementation for a CC3200 SPI peripheral used with the SDSPI driver |
| SDSPIEUSCIA.h | SDSPI driver implementation for a USCI SPI peripheral used with the SDSPI driver |
| SDSPIEUSCIB.h | SDSPI driver implementation for a USCI SPI peripheral used with the SDSPI driver |
| SDSPIMSP432.h | SDSPI driver implementation using an EUSCI SPI peripheral for MSP432 |
| SDSPITiva.h | SDSPI driver implementation for a Tiva SPI peripheral used with the SDSPI driver |
| SDSPIUSCIA.h | SDSPI driver implementation for a USCI SPI peripheral used with the SDSPI driver |
| SDSPIUSCIB.h | SDSPI driver implementation for a USCI SPI peripheral used with the SDSPI driver |
| SemaphoreP.h | Semaphore module for the RTOS Porting Interface |
| SensorBmp280.h | Driver for the Bosch BMP280 Pressure Sensor |
| SensorHdc1000.h | Driver for Texas Instruments HCD1000 humidity sensor |
| SensorI2C.h | Simple interface to the TI-RTOS driver. Also manages switching between I2C-buses |
| SensorMpu9250.h | Driver for the InvenSense MPU9250 Motion Processing Unit |
| SensorOpt3001.h | Driver for the Texas Instruments OPT3001 Optical Sensor |
| SensorTagTest.h | Test code for SensorTag |
| SensorTmp007.h | Driver for the Texas Instruments TMP007 infra-red thermopile sensor |
| SensorUtil.h | Common utility code for SensorTag |
| SharpGrLib.h | |
| SPI.h | SPI driver interface |
| SPICC26XXDMA.h | SPI driver implementation for a CC26XX SPI controller using the UDMA controller |
| SPICC3200DMA.h | SPI driver implementation for a CC3200 SPI controller using the micro DMA controller |
| SPIEUSCIADMA.h | SPI driver implementation for a USCIA peripheral using the micro DMA controller |
| SPIEUSCIBDMA.h | SPI driver implementation for a USCIB peripheral using the micro DMA controller |
| SPIMSP432DMA.h | SPI driver implementation for a EUSCI peripheral on MSP432 using the micro DMA controller |
| SPITivaDMA.h | SPI driver implementation for a TivaSPIcontroller using the micro DMA controller |
| SPIUSCIADMA.h | SPI driver implementation for a USCIA peripheral using the micro DMA controller |
| SPIUSCIBDMA.h | SPI driver implementation for a USCIB peripheral using the micro DMA controller |
| tirtos_config.h | |
| UART.h | UART driver interface |
| UARTCC26XX.h | UART driver implementation for a CC26XX UART controller |
| UARTCC3200.h | UART driver implementation for a CC3200 UART controller |
| UARTCC3200DMA.h | UART driver implementation for a CC3200 UART controller, using the micro DMA controller |
| UARTEUSCIA.h | UART driver implementation for a EUSCIA peripheral |
| UARTMSP432.h | UART driver implementation for a EUSCIA peripheral for MSP432 |
| UARTTiva.h | UART driver implementation for a Tiva UART controller |
| UARTTivaDMA.h | UART driver implementation for a Tiva UART controller thay uses DMA |
| UARTUSCIA.h | UART driver implementation for a USCIA peripheral |
| UDMACC26XX.h | UDMACC26XX driver implementation |
| UDMACC3200.h | UDMA driver implementation for CC3200 |
| UDMAMSP432.h | UDMA driver implementation for MSP432 |
| USBMSCHFatFs.h | USBMSCHFatFs driver interface |
| USBMSCHFatFsTiva.h | USBMSCHFatFs driver implementation for a Tiva USB controller used with the USBMSCHFatFs driver |
| Watchdog.h | Watchdog driver interface |
| WatchdogCC26XX.h | Watchdog driver implementation for CC13XX/CC26XX |
| WatchdogCC3200.h | Watchdog driver implementation for CC3200 |
| WatchdogMSP430.h | Watchdog driver implementation for MSP430 |
| WatchdogMSP432.h | Watchdog driver implementation for MSP432 |
| WatchdogTiva.h | Watchdog driver implementation for Tiva |
| WiFi.h | WiFi driver interface |
| WiFiCC3100.h | WiFi driver implementation for the SimpleLink Wi-Fi CC3100 device |
| WiFiCC3200.h | WiFi driver implementation for the SimpleLink Wi-Fi CC3200 device |